RATIONALE AND OBJECTIVES: Coronary artery stents reduce the rate of restenosis in patients who have undergone balloon angioplasty; therefore, the implantation of coronary stents represents an important method in the treatment of coronary stenoses. The authors' purpose was to investigate the usefulness of electron-beam computed tomography (CT) as a noninvasive means of assessing the patency of coronary artery stents in patients who had undergone balloon angioplasty and stent placement. MATERIALS AND METHODS: Electron-beam CT was used to assess stent patency in 177 patients with 285 stents. Contrast material-enhanced multisection flow studies were performed, and the images were evaluated by three investigators and compared with the findings of coronary angiography. RESULTS: Cine loop evaluations and time-attenuation curve analysis led to the correct diagnosis in 167 (94.3%) patients, as confirmed with coronary angiography. Stenoses had occurred in 18 of the 194 vessels with stents, and 14 of these were detected with electron-beam CT. CONCLUSION: Electron-beam CT appears to be a valuable imaging modality in the noninvasive assessment of stent patency in coronary arteries.  相似文献

Heterogeneity of carcass trait variances due to level of Brahman inheritance was investigated using records from straightbred and crossbred steers produced from 1970 to 1988 (n = 1,530). Angus, Brahman, Charolais, and Hereford sires were mated to straightbred and crossbred cows to produce straightbred, F1, back-cross, three-breed cross, and two-, three-, and four-breed rotational crossbred steers in four non-overlapping generations. At weaning (mean age = 220 d), steers were randomly assigned within breed group directly to the feedlot for 200 d, or to a backgrounding and stocker phase before feeding. Stocker steers were fed from 70 to 100 d in generations 1 and 2 and from 60 to 120 d in generations 3 and 4. Carcass traits included hot carcass weight, subcutaneous fat thickness and longissimus muscle area at the 12-13th rib interface, carcass weight-adjusted longissimus muscle area, USDA yield grade, estimated total lean yield, marbling score, and Warner-Bratzler shear force. Steers were classified as either high Brahman (50 to 100% Brahman), moderate Brahman (25 to 49% Brahman), or low Brahman (0 to 24% Brahman) inheritance. Two types of animal models were fit with regard to level of Brahman inheritance. One model assumed similar variances between pairs of Brahman inheritance groups, and the second model assumed different variances between pairs of Brahman inheritance groups. Fixed sources of variation in both models included direct and maternal additive and nonadditive breed effects, year of birth, and slaughter age. Variances were estimated using derivative free REML procedures. Likelihood ratio tests were used to compare models. The model accounting for heterogeneous variances had a greater likelihood (P < .001) than the model assuming homogeneous variances for hot carcass weight, longissimus muscle area, weight-adjusted longissimus muscle area, total lean yield, and Warner-Bratzler shear force, indicating improved fit with percentage Brahman inheritance considered as a source of heterogeneity of variance. Genetic covariances estimated from the model accounting for heterogeneous variances resulted in genetic correlations of or near unity. These results suggest that different genetic values be considered for genetic evaluation of carcass yield and shear force traits from steers with different degrees of Brahman inheritance.  相似文献

Three non-identical, full length troponin-I (Tn-I) clones were isolated from an Atlantic salmon myotomal (trunk) muscle cDNA library. The primary structures, which are predicted to range from 172 to 180 amino acids in length, exhibit similar percent identity scores when compared with fast, slow and cardiac specific Tn-Is from higher vertebrates. When the sequence data are considered along with the results of Western blotting it is evident that Tn-I is more heterogeneous in Atlantic salmon than has been previously shown in higher vertebrates.  相似文献

We examined whether different word displays also differ in terms of the format in which they are represented in memory. Undergraduates studied a text, an outline, a graphic organizer, or a concept map and then were shown either a verbal (digits) or spatial (dots) display. They were then tested on comprehension of the first display and recognition of the second display. Comprehending graphic organizers and concept maps interfered with the spatial concurrent task and vice versa, whereas the verbal concurrent task interfered with comprehension of texts and outlines. These results are consistent with the conjoint retention hypothesis suggesting that spatial encoding may explain the facilitative effects of graphic organizers and concept maps. A convenient and rapid micro-anion exchange liquid chromatography (LC) tandem electrospray mass spectrometry (MS) procedure was developed for quantitative analysis in serum of O-isopropyl methylphosphonic acid (IMPA), the hydrolysis product of the nerve agent sarin. The mass spectrometric procedure involves negative or positive ion electrospray ionization and multiple reaction monitoring (MRM) detection. The method could be successfully applied to the analysis of serum samples from victims of the Tokyo subway attack and of an earlier incident at Matsumoto, Japan. IMPA levels ranging from 2 to 135 ng/ml were found. High levels of IMPA appear to correlate with low levels of residual butyrylcholinesterase activity in the samples and vice versa. Based on our analyses, the internal and exposure doses of the victims were estimated. In several cases, the doses appeared to be substantially higher than the assumed lethal doses in man.  相似文献

OBJECTIVE: To assess the prevalence, severity, and correlates of chronic pain in a community-based sample of men with spinal cord injury (SCI). DESIGN: Survey. SETTING: Community. PARTICIPANTS: Seventy-seven men with SCI randomly selected from a sampling frame solicited from the community. METHOD: Participants completed standardized questionnaires assessing many areas of life, were interviewed in their homes, and underwent a physical examination at a hospital. There they were interviewed by an anesthesiologist regarding chronic pain, and a nurse administered objective pain measures. RESULTS: Seventy-five percent of the men reported chronic pain. Chronic pain was associated with more depressive symptoms, more perceived stress, and poorer self-assessed health. Greater intensity of pain was related to less paralytic impairment, violent etiology, and more perceived stress. Area of the body affected by pain was related to independence and mobility. CONCLUSIONS: Because of the high prevalence of chronic pain in the population with SCI and its relation to disability, handicap, and quality of life, health care providers need to give this issue the same priority given to other SCI health issues. Analysis of individual pain components provides better information than assessing overall pain. It is futile to treat SCI pain without giving full attention to subjective factors.  相似文献

C-peptide, which is released from the pancreatic beta cells into the circulation in amounts equimolar with insulin, fulfills an important function in the assembly of the two-chain insulin structure, but has otherwise been considered to be biologically inactive. However, during the last few years several experimental and clinical studies have demonstrated that replacement of C-peptide in patients with insulin-dependent diabetes mellitus elicits several physiological effects. Thus, during short-term substitution of C-peptide (1-3 h) decreased glomerular hyperfiltration, augmented whole body and skeletal muscle glucose utilisation, improved autonomic nerve function and a redistribution of microvascular skin blood flow could be observed. In addition, replacement of C-peptide during a period of 1-3 months has been shown to improve renal function as well as autonomic and sensory nerve function in IDDM patients. The mechanisms behind these effects remain unclear, but recent investigations have indicated that an increase in Na+K+ATPase activity and a stimulation of the endothelial nitric oxide synthase may contribute to the observed physiological effects of C-peptide. Not only the intact C-peptide molecule, but also fragments from the C-terminal and mid-portion of the molecule have been shown to exert biological effects. Further research will be necessary to evaluate the underlying mechanism and the clinical impact of C-peptide replacement in IDDM patients.  相似文献

The crystal structure of the cyclin D-dependent kinase Cdk6 bound to the p19 INK4d protein has been determined at 1.9 A resolution. The results provide the first structural information for a cyclin D-dependent protein kinase and show how the INK4 family of CDK inhibitors bind. The structure indicates that the conformational changes induced by p19INK4d inhibit both productive binding of ATP and the cyclin-induced rearrangement of the kinase from an inactive to an active conformation. The structure also shows how binding of an INK4 inhibitor would prevent binding of p27Kip1, resulting in its redistribution to other CDKs. Identification of the critical residues involved in the interaction explains how mutations in Cdk4 and p16INK4a result in loss of kinase inhibition and cancer.  相似文献
